What we collect
- From contractors: name, email, company name, password hash, and the content of reports they author (property address, repair descriptions, severity, photos).
- From homeowners: mobile number (provided to the contractor at the job site) and, if they create a WorkCaddie account, their name and email.
- Automatically: timestamps when reports are sent and viewed. No ad-tech trackers, no third-party analytics, no fingerprinting.
How we use it
Personal information is used solely to deliver the WorkCaddie service: storing reports on behalf of the contractor, sending the SMS link to the homeowner, and displaying saved reports to the homeowner.
Mobile numbers and SMS
Mobile numbers collected for SMS delivery are not sold, rented, or shared with third parties for marketing purposes. Numbers are transmitted to our SMS provider (Twilio) solely to deliver the report link and to process STOP/HELP responses. See our SMS consent & messaging terms.
AI-generated explanations
Reports can include short explanations that are AI-generated. Your contractor writes every entry on a report — the findings, photos, severity, and any pricing. AI only adds general educational context about what a finding typically means; it does not inspect your home, set prices, or make recommendations. AI-generated text is labeled on the report, and your contractor reviews the report before sending it.
Sharing
We do not sell personal information. We share data only with infrastructure providers needed to run the service (Google Firebase for storage and authentication, Twilio for SMS delivery), each under their own enterprise-grade security and privacy commitments.
Retention
Reports are retained for the life of the contractor or homeowner account. Homeowners can remove saved reports from their WorkCaddie at any time. Contact us to request deletion of your data.
